In 2023, the import value of glass bottles and related products to Brazil stood at $89.5 million. Forecast data indicates a consistent upward trend from 2024 through 2028, with a projected increase reaching $94.904 million. Year-on-year growth highlights a steady rise of approximately 1.2% to 1.3% annually. Over the five-year period, the compound annual growth rate (CAGR) is estimated at about 1.3%.
Future trends to watch for include:
- The potential impact of sustainability initiatives on import demand for recyclable glass containers.
- Changes in consumer behavior towards eco-friendly packaging potentially increasing glass demand.
- Economic factors and trade policies affecting importation costs and market dynamics.
